MIDLAND, TEXAS - Buckner Family Place will hold a ribbon-cutting and open house for its new facilities this morning as two new families move in. The additions to the nonprofit’s living space include an activity center and one new duplex featuring two three-bedroom apartments.

“We’re just thrilled that this stage is coming to a close and that it can be completed and fully up and running,” said Myndi Easter, Buckner gift officer. “Midland is such a generous community. We would not be able to serve these families and these ladies without the community standing behind us and this program.”

Easter said while all of the previously-built apartments on the site are two-bedroom, it had become clear the average family size of clients was more suited to a three-bedroom set-up ...”
